Section R9-5-303 - Posting of Notices
A. A licensee shall post in a place that can be conspicuously viewed by individuals entering or leaving the facility or activity area the:
1. Facility's license;
2. Name of the facility director;
3. Name of the individual designated to act on behalf of the facility director when the facility director is not present in the facility, as prescribed by R9-5-301(B)(1);
4. Schedule of child care services fees and policy for refunding fees as prescribed by A.R.S. § 36-882(P);
5. Breakfast, lunch, dinner, and snack menus for each calendar week at the beginning of the calendar week;
6. Notice of the presence of any communicable disease or infestation listed in 9 A.A.C. 6, Article 2, Table 2, from the date of discovery through the incubation period of the communicable disease or infestation;
7. Notice of the Department's intent to deny, revoke, or suspend as prescribed by A.R.S. § 36-888 at the expiration of time in the notice for the licensee to respond;
8. Notice of an intermediate sanction imposed as prescribed by A.R.S. § 36-891.01 within 10 calendar days after the licensee received notice of the intermediate sanction;
9. Notice of a legal injunction imposed as prescribed by A.R.S. § 36-886.01 when the licensee receives the legal injunction; and
10. Notice of the availability of facility inspection reports for public viewing at the facility premises.
B. A licensee shall ensure that the licensed capacity of each indoor activity area is posted in that activity area.
C. Except as prescribed in A.R.S. § 36-898(C), a licensee shall post a notification of pesticide application in each activity area and in each entrance of a facility, at least 48 hours before a pesticide is applied on the facility's premises, containing:
1. The date and time of the pesticide application, and
2. A statement that written pesticide information is available from the licensee upon request.

Ariz. Admin. Code § R9-5-303

Adopted effective December 12, 1986 (Supp. 86-6). Section repealed; new Section adopted effective October 17, 1997 (Supp. 97-4). Amended by final rulemaking at 13 A.A.R. 3492, effective December 1, 2007 (Supp. 07-4). Amended by exempt rulemaking at 16 A.A.R. 1564, effective September 30, 2010 (Supp. 10-3). Amended by final expedited rulemaking at 24 A.A.R. 3429, effective 12/5/2018.
